TEENAGE KICKED.
sneak
Head over heals through a car windscreen.
Ambitions charred by gasoline.
Go-faster stripes go nowhere fast.
The furry dice has just been cast.
A parents tears won't quench the flame.
High spirits soar to claim the blame.
They always have and always will.
Their boredom has the night to kill.
Nowhere to run, nowhere to ride.
High-pressure hoses aim to hide -
the fragile fate of eager youth,
as floral tributes mark their truth.
Enthusiasm coughs and stalls.
A congregation met with walls -
of disapproving sullen sighs.
Beyond the black horizon lies -
disgruntled youth driven too far.
A fight for life in mangled car.
A teenage kick that dented fate.
Their parents sit and wait and wait...
